In a decisive and newsworthy victory, the sex abuse attorneys at Manly, Stewart & Finaldi have earned two separate verdicts in excess of 3 million dollars for two young clients who were molested close to five years ago by their teacher. The abuser – Mr. Paul Chapel III – was first arrested and tried for sex abuse against minors some 15 years ago but kept his job all the while. For this criminal violation, he was actually convicted for his crimes back in 2012. The Los Angeles Unified School District (LAUSD) settled out of court with some of his 13 victims. The trial in for these two boys shone a light on the misconduct of the Los Angeles Unified School District with respect to its negligent hiring and supervision of Paul Chapel III, paving the way to this legal victory.

LAUSD and its representatives argued to the jury that each boy’s trauma was not directly related to the sexual abuse. They argued that instead they suffered from the events of their own fathers’ deaths, as well as their own developmental challenges. Furthermore, the district stated that the boys were doing well and no longer seemed to suffer from any traumatization. They proposed just $490,000 for each victim.

The compassionate and knowledgeable lawyers at Manly, Stewart & Finaldi, undeterred, fought for reasonable compensation for these boys, believing that it was shameful for the district to blame the victims and their parents for their damages. This motivated them to fight even harder for a larger and deserved compensation amount.
